127 BPM — squarely in deep house territory, mixable within roughly 122–132 BPM without pitch artefacts.
E Minor — 9A on the Camelot wheel. Harmonically compatible with 9B, 8A and 10A.
Tracks in 9A, 9B, 8A or 10A between ~122–132 BPM.
Groove sustainer — 37% energy with strong groove keeps momentum without forcing the energy up. Ideal in the stretches between peaks.

9A → 9A
Same key, ±2 BPM. With 84% groove and heavy bass, long blends work — cut the incoming bass until the switch.

9A → 9B
Relative major — brighter key, same tonal centre. Pair it with a higher-energy record and the floor keeps moving.
9A → 8A · 10A
Adjacent keys through a breakdown. This one runs 7:20 — the outro gives you a full phrase to work with.
